Good reasons for joining the Army as a musician are:

  • 800 plus musicians in the Corps of Army Music
  • 22 Bands in the Corps of Music + The Band of The Brigade of Gurkhas
  • Great travel opportunities
  • Fantastic sports and adventurous training
  • Live performance in some of the greatest venues all over the world
  • A structured career
  • Train and earn musical qualifications - Diplomas and a possible degree in music
  • Paid to perform music
  • Full Time salaried and pensionable career
  • Potential employment until age 55

The Corps of Army Music can accept all instrumentalists including:

  • Brass
  • Woodwind
  • Percussion
  • Piano/Keyboards
  • Strings
  • Guitars
  • Vocals

The band and Corps run residential 'Insight' courses in each year. The courses are available to anyone over the age of 14, who plays a musical instrument to at least ABRSM grade 5 or equivalent standard.

There are other courses throughout the year at other bands or the Royal Military School of Music.

The course, which is completely free, will provide an honest and realistic insight into army life within the Corps of Army Music and indeed the band. This includes working along side the band and learning some basic military skills.
